Dr. Sire begins his talk by asserting that the mechanism of belief is inescapable in life. In addition, the question of why we believe what we do has been of ultimate importance for all people, at all times, and in all places. Arguing that we must learn to make the fine distinction between reasons to believe and causes of belief, Dr. Sire examines the social, psychological, genetic, and religious theories of belief by employing this distinction to each category. Finally, Dr. Sire argues that what one believes must cohere to reality, and he offers several arguments that the Christian faith is a system of belief that does just this.

    Importance of Belief | In this digital download released by the Veritas Forum, Christian thinker James W. Sire explains why belief is central to human existence. He argues provacatively that belief is so fundamental to how we interact with reality, that it makes the distinction between religion and science a moot point. Sire then traces how we are taught to believe at an early age and how in adulthood that early exposure to a system can change, grow and help form what we become. |
